    Job Overview
    As a Disassembly Estimator, you will be responsible for both disassembling vehicles to thoroughly accessing all related damage and creating precise repair estimates according to OEM repair procedures from the vehicle manufacturer. This dual role requires knowledge in vehicle anotomy and attention to detail, as well as the ability to operate tools and equipment. Problem solving and communication skills are essential to meet company standards of safe and proper repairs.

    Job Duties
    Scanning vehicles
    Disassemble vehicles
    Organize disassembled parts
    Inspect vehicles and parts for damage (broke, scratched, dented, cracked, peeling, etc.)
    Document damage
    Create supplements
    Effectively communicate with insurance and clients
    Assemble vehicles to factory specifications
    Collaborate and effectively communicate with team members and insurance adjusters
    Maintain a well organized work environment
    Research repair procedures
    Perform additional tasks that are assigned by manager
    Problem solve
    Inspect vehicles to meet company standards
